Miele Wash Pump Failure: Causes, Symptoms, and Solutions
A typical machine wash motor issue can be a disappointing experience. Several reasons can result in this defect. Objects like coins are a leading factor, as they can block the motor. Additionally, scale, over time, can affect the motor's components. Symptoms typically include a obvious grinding noise during the wash cycle, liquid not draining properly, or an signal displayed on the display. Solutions include manually clearing any debris to substituting the broken pump itself. A certified technician is suggested for more serious repairs to ensure proper diagnosis and resolution.
Replacing a Faulty Miele Circulation Pump – A Step-by-Step Guide
Dealing with a malfunctioning Miele dishwasher? A frequent culprit is a damaged circulation pump. This guide will walk you through the process of swapping it. First, disconnect the power supply to your appliance. Next, find the pump – it’s usually positioned at the bottom of the machine. You’ll use a screwdriver (often a Phillips head) to release the power connections and any holding brackets. Carefully extract the old pump, noting its position for proper setup of the substitute unit. Finally, connect the new pump in reverse order, ensuring all wires are firmly attached before restoring power. Remember to consult your Miele’s specific instructions for model-specific details, as procedures may change.
